  50g Caviar Tin: Raw Material Selection Logic and Quality Traceability of High-End Aquatic Packaging

  In the high-end luxury aquatic packaging track, the50g caviar tin is a high-threshold precision metal packaging product. Unlike ordinary food cans, caviar tins impose strict industrial requirements on raw material purity, chemical stability, corrosion resistance, and airtight pressure resistance. Caviar features tender flesh, high salt content, and abundant active substances, which are extremely susceptible to oxidative contamination by metal ions. Therefore, raw material quality directly determines the shelf life, taste retention, and edible safety of caviar. From the perspective of raw materials, this paper deeply analyzes the substrate standards, tin plating technology, coating system, auxiliary materials, industrial pain points, and material iteration trends of 50g special caviar tins, and explores the raw material supply chain barriers behind high-end food metal packaging.

  Tinplate substrate: High-grade special tinplate builds the basic framework of corrosion resistance and compression resistance. As a miniature thin-walled precision can, the 50g caviar tin adopts a strictly controlled wall thickness of 0.20mm to 0.24mm, different from the 0.28mm conventional plate for ordinary dry food cans. The raw material must be low-sulfur and low-carbon cold-rolled tinplate, mainly including T5 hard-grade tinplate and customized MRT food-grade special steel strips, with tensile strength exceeding 420MPa. It effectively avoids stamping cracking, tank rebound and micro-deformation under thin-wall conditions. Given the strong corrosiveness of high-salt caviar, recycled impure iron substrates are strictly prohibited. Primary raw steel billets are required, with internal impurities strictly controlled: arsenic content ≤0.030%, and the total content of lead and cadmium shall not exceed the standard, eliminating heavy metal precipitation and pollution from the source. At present, high-end caviar tins mostly adopt food-grade special tinplates from Wuhan Iron and Steel and Baosteel, with purity far exceeding that of general packaging steel.

  Tin plating layer: Precisely controlled electroplated tin layer resists electrochemical corrosion caused by salt. High-salt aquatic products have extremely high requirements for tin plating technology. While the tin coating weight of ordinary food cans is 2.8/2.8g/㎡, the special raw materials for 50g caviar tins are increased to 5.6/5.6g/㎡ with double-sided uniform electroplating. The thickness tolerance of the tin layer is controlled within ±0.2g/m². The dense and uniform pure tin coating forms a physical isolation film to block contact between high-salt caviar and the steel substrate, preventing electrochemical corrosion and metallic odor. Meanwhile, the raw materials adopt chromate passivation technology to generate a protective passivation film on the tin surface, improving moisture and oxidation resistance to adapt to the high humidity and temperature difference environment of cold chain storage and cross-border shipping. Inferior cans usually adopt thin tin plating and secondary tin plating raw materials, prone to inner wall black spots and salt corrosion after short-term storage, which is the core raw material difference between high-end and low-end caviar tins.

  Internal coating raw materials: Food-grade anti-corrosion coating preserves the original flavor of ingredients. Besides the substrate and tin layer, the internal spray coating is the key raw material for caviar anticorrosion and fresh-keeping. 50g caviar tins compulsorily adopt BPA-free food-grade epoxy phenolic coatings, different from low-cost baking paint for ordinary cans. The coating raw materials must pass FDA and GB 4806.9-2023 food contact detection, featuring acid and salt resistance to withstand long-term immersion corrosion in a 4℃ cold chain. The spraying thickness is evenly controlled at 6-8μm without pinholes or missing coating, avoiding deterioration caused by caviar protein adsorption on the metal inner wall. In terms of the raw material supply chain, high-end caviar tins generally adopt imported modified anti-corrosion coatings, while mid-end products use domestic food-grade alternative raw materials. Industrial recycled coatings are strictly prohibited to ensure the original sweet taste of caviar without material odor interference.

  Sealing auxiliary raw materials: Medical-grade sealant creates a vacuum fresh-keeping airtight environment. Most 50g caviar tins adopt vacuum sealing technology, and the rubber sealing glue of the can lid serves as the core auxiliary raw material. The industrial selection standard is food-grade butyl rubber, which is odorless, resistant to high and low temperatures, and saltwater corrosion, suitable for cold chain storage and long-distance cross-border transportation. The colloid raw materials feature high elasticity and aging resistance with a compression resilience rate above 95%. Combined with high-precision crimping technology, the internal vacuum degree is stably maintained at -0.09MPa to isolate oxygen and delay fat oxidation. Compared with low-cost recycled rubber raw materials for ordinary dry food cans, the special sealant for caviar contains no plasticizers or harmful additives, with procurement costs more than three times higher, serving as an essential auxiliary material to guarantee the 12-18 months long shelf life of caviar.

  External printing raw materials and technology: Friction-resistant food-grade ink balances aesthetics and safety. The printing raw materials for high-end caviar tins also follow strict selection standards. Solvent-free environmental iron printing ink is adopted to adapt to low-temperature refrigeration with moisture-proof, anti-fading and scratch-resistant properties. The ink contains no heavy metal pigments with strong adhesion, avoiding peeling and blurring caused by low-temperature condensation. Auxiliary coating materials such as matte varnish and wear-resistant varnish are applied to enhance the metallic texture and high-end luxury positioning. In terms of raw material management, high-end brand caviar tins implement an ink batch traceability system, with food contact detection reports provided for each batch to eliminate precipitation risks of printing raw materials.

  Current raw material industry pain points restrict standardized industrial development. Firstly, the production capacity of high-end food-grade tinplates is scarce. Special substrates with high tin coating and low impurities are in tight supply, with procurement prices 35%-50% higher than ordinary tinplates, raising the entry threshold for small and medium-sized enterprises. Secondly, high-end anti-corrosion coatings and imported sealants are monopolized by leading chemical enterprises, resulting in concentrated supply chain bargaining power and obvious raw material cost fluctuations. Thirdly, low-end counterfeit products flood the market. Some manufacturers adopt inferior raw materials such as downgraded tin plating, recycled steel and industrial ink to seize the market at low prices, causing potential food safety hazards including corrosion, peculiar smell and excessive heavy metals, disrupting the selection standards of high-end raw materials.

  In 2026, the raw material supply chain is accelerating localization and high-end upgrading. Domestic iron and steel enterprises continuously optimize the smelting technology of food-grade special tinplates to realize mass production of high-purity thin-wall substrates. Chemical enterprises break through the technical bottleneck of BPA-free anti-corrosion coatings to replace imported high-end coatings. Future raw material development will focus on three directions: high-purity primary steel substrates, thickened uniform tin plating, and bio-based environmental coatings. For can manufacturers, strictly controlling raw material access standards, building a stable high-end raw material supply chain, and establishing a material traceability system are the core barriers to delve into the high-end caviar packaging track. Relying on stringent raw material selection, 50g caviar tins continuously consolidate the quality advantages of high-end aquatic packaging, promoting the raw material industry of metal packaging to upgrade toward higher purity, safety and precision.
